Iranian president expresses full backing for Syrian government

Baku, Azerbaijan, June 2

By Umid Niayesh - Trend:

Iranian president Hassan Rouhani has expressed full support of the Islamic Republic for the Syrian government. Iran will stay on the side of the Syrian people and government until the end, Rouhani said.

The Iranian president made the remarks during a meeting with Syrian speaker, Mohammad Jihad al-Laham in Tehran on June 2.

Rouhani also expressed hope that the Syrian army would be the winner of the fight with "terrorists," the official website of the president said.

He further stated that terrorists could not overcome the Syrian people.

"Thankfully today after four years of resistance, hope of the Syria's enemies about capturing Damascus in a few months is gone and their plans have failed," Rouhani said.

"We are sure that the foreign countries will not be able to impose their conditions on the Syrian people," he added.

Iran is a close ally of the Syrian government and has always shown its support for the regime of Syrian President Bashar al Assad.

Syrian opposition claim that Iranian military forces are fighting against them, while Iran dismisses the claims, saying that Iran only has advisors in Syria, to transfer its military experience to the Syrian army.

During the conflict in Syria, which began in March 2011, more than 150,000 people have been killed in the country and over 4.2 million have become refugees in Syrian territory and two million have fled to neighboring countries.
